CHIMNEY ROCK, N.C. -- More than 1,000 people woke up very early Easter morning to journey to Chimney Rock State Park for the 57th annual Easter Sunrise Service.
Kim Smith --who lives in Charlotte and is an assistant professor in the department of journalism and mass communication at North Carolina A&T State University in Greensboro -- took his camera along to capture the sights and sounds of Christians celebrating the resurrection of Jesus Christ in the beauty of the western North Carolina mountains.
